TM 9-<strong>2330</strong>-<strong>202</strong>-14&P4-35.1 SERVICE BRAKE MAINTENANCE (M101A1 AND M116A1).This Task Covers:a. Removalc. Cleaning and Inspectionb. Disassemblyd. Installatione. AssemblyInitial Setup:Tools/Test Equipment:• General mechanic’s tool kit (Item 1, Appendix B)• Common No. 1 tool set (Item 2, Appendix B)Materials/Parts:• Rag (Item 13, Appendix F)• Solvent, drycleaning (Item 15, Appendix F)• Clip (3), 10911060Equipment Conditions:• Wheel and tire assembly removed (para 4-44)• Hub and brakedrum removed (para 4-43.1)a. REMOVALWARNINGDO NOT handle brakeshoes, brakedrums, or other components unless area hasbeen properly cleaned. Asbestos dust, which can be dangerous if you touch it orbreathe it, may be on these components. Wear an approved filter mask and gloves.NEVER use compressed air or a dry brush to clean brake components. Dust may beremoved using an industrial-type vacuum cleaner. Clean dust or mud away frombrake components with water and a wet, soft brush or cloth. Failure to follow thiswarning may result in serious illness or death to personnel.NOTEIt is not necessary to remove backing plate and service brake assembly from axle inorder to disassemble service brake assembly. Disassembly may be performed withservice brake assembly on axle or on work bench.1. Unhook swaged sleeve (1) from parking brake lever (2).2. Remove five nuts (3), capscrews (4), and backing plate (5) from axle (6).4-60 Change 2
